Block 689,624

Block Hash

f7f29d59c517642e1fe64b385718eaef2bfa7bddb9ebb766dcbccd27e1409b73

Previous Block Hash

486a45106c53ce76ad352f7f688b2f203f780939e468b609c12174d50ee71754

Mined

Transactions

4

Difficulty

29.57 M

Size

850 bytes

Transactions (4)

1 input, 1 output
10,000.00679001 PEPE
1 input, 2 outputs
105,578.97279815 PEPE
1 input, 2 outputs
62,704.90088 PEPE
1 input, 2 outputs
62,703.89862 PEPE